India’s Test specialist Cheteshwar Pujara registered his first Test century in almost four years on Friday (December 16) in the ongoing first Test match between India and Bangladesh at the Zahur Ahmed Chowdhury Stadium in Chattogram. Yes, after a long wait of 1443 days, Cheteshwar Pujara finally raised his bat as he smashed a century.

Pujara Registered The Fastest Century Of His Career

This was also is also the fastest century of his Test career. He smashed the Bangladesh bowling attack to reach the triple figure in just 130 balls. His unbeaten knock of 102 included a total of 13 boundaries as he showed no mercy to a struggling Bangladesh bowling attack after the Indian cricket team took a 254-run lead in the first innings.

Pujara’s last century came against Australia at the Sydney Cricket Ground (SCG) on 2nd January 2019. Pujara’s knock had played a crucial role in India’s incredible win in the series, which saw the right-handed batter amass more than 600 runs (including 1 double ton and a century). With the help of Pujara’s contribution, the Indian side registered a first Test series win on Australian soil for the first time in history under Virat Kohli’s captaincy.

After registering his 19th ton, there was a genuine delight on Pujara’s face. However, it was the reaction of Virat Kohli, whose reaction has gone crazily viral on the internet. 

Virat Kohli, who was at the non-striker’s end, was overjoyed as Pujara celebrated his ton. Virat walked towards Pujara and gave him a warm hug.

Meanwhile, Pujara isn’t the only Indian player to have scored a hundred in the second innings. Opening batter Shubman Gill also reached the triple-digit score, registering a knock of 110 off 152 balls. At the end of Day 3, the hosts were 42/0, with Najmul Hossain Shanto and Zakir Hasan in the middle.
